Description based upon print version of record.. - Contents; Preface; One: Introduction; Two: Definitions and Classifications; Three: Examples and Texts; Four: Scholarship and Approaches; Five: Contexts; Glossary; Bibliography; Web Resources; Index. - Hoodoo, voodoo, and conjure are part of a mysterious world of African American spirituality that has long captured the popular imagination. These magical beliefs and practices have figured in literary works by such authors as Toni Morrison, Alice Walker, and Ishmael Reed, and they have been central to numerous films, such as The Skeleton Key. Written for students and general readers, this book is a convenient introduction to hoodoo, voodoo, and conjure.The volume begins by defining and classifying elements of these spiritual traditions.
